Step 1: Conduct AI-Powered Keyword Clustering
Your first step isn't to find a single keyword; it's to build a map of your entire topic authority. AI excels at finding semantic relationships between queries that humans would miss. Instead of guessing which long-tail keywords belong together in an article, a clustering tool does this for you based on search results (SERP) overlap.
For example, a manual approach might lead you to write separate articles for "how to clean a coffee maker," "descaling a coffee machine," and "coffee maker cleaning solution." An AI clustering tool will analyze the top-ranking pages for all three and likely tell you they belong in a single, comprehensive guide because Google ranks the same pages for these queries. This prevents keyword cannibalization and builds topical authority much faster.
Action:- Export a large list of 500-5,000 potential keywords from a tool like Ahrefs.
- Import this list into your AI SEO platform's clustering feature.
- The tool will group these keywords into topical clusters, with each cluster representing a future article. A good tool will identify the primary keyword for each cluster based on volume and difficulty.
Step 2: Generate Content Briefs at Scale
With your clusters defined, you can now create optimized content briefs. An AI-powered brief is more than a list of keywords. It's a detailed blueprint based on a real-time analysis of the top-ranking competitors for your cluster's primary keyword.
These briefs should automatically outline:
- Target word count: Based on the average length of top-performing content.
- Key headings (H2s, H3s): Analyzing the common structure of the top 10 results.
- Must-include entities and topics: Identifying related concepts (NLP terms) that Google expects to see.
- Internal link opportunities: Suggesting relevant pages on your own site to link to.
- External link targets: Recommending authoritative sources to cite.

Step 4: Automate On-Page SEO Elements
Writing the body content is only one part of the equation. AI can automate the most tedious on-page SEO tasks that are often overlooked.
Your AI SEO platform should be able to instantly generate:
- SEO Title: Optimized for the primary keyword, with a compelling angle to increase click-through rate (CTR).
- Meta Description: A concise, keyword-rich summary that accurately reflects the content and encourages clicks from the SERP.
- URL Slug: A short, keyword-focused slug.
- Image Alt Text: Using AI image recognition to describe images for accessibility and search engine crawlers.
- Schema Markup: Generating
Article,FAQPage, orHowTostructured data to help Google understand your content and grant rich snippets. A 2020 study showed that pages with rich snippets can have a significantly higher CTR.
Step 5: Implement an AI-Driven Internal Linking Strategy
Internal linking is a powerful but chronically underutilized SEO tactic. It helps search engines understand your site structure, distributes link equity (PageRank), and guides users to relevant content. Doing it manually is a nightmare.
AI tools solve this by constantly scanning your site's content. When you publish a new article, the AI can:
- Find contextual linking opportunities on your existing pages to point to the new article.
- Suggest relevant links from the new article to older, authoritative posts.
Don't just publish content into a void. An AI-driven internal linking tool acts as a traffic controller, ensuring every new post is woven into the fabric of your site architecture from day one.
Step 6: Monitor Technical SEO and Performance Data
An AI SEO optimization engine isn't a "set it and forget it" machine. It's a system that learns and adapts. The final component is automated monitoring.
Your platform should integrate with Google Search Console and analytics tools to track performance and alert you to issues. This includes:
- Rank Tracking: Monitoring positions for your target keyword clusters.
- Technical Health: Flagging crawl errors, mobile usability issues, or changes in Core Web Vitals. Google's guidance on Core Web Vitals makes it clear these are important user experience signals.
- Content Decay: Identifying pages that are losing traffic and rankings, flagging them for a refresh.
Troubleshooting Your AI SEO Engine
Even with a powerful system, you might hit some bumps. Here are a few common problems and how to solve them.
- "My AI Content Sounds Robotic." This happens when you rely 100% on the AI draft without human oversight. The AI is your analyst and drafter, not your final editor. Always have a human review, edit, and inject unique insights, brand voice, and real-world examples into the content. The AI provides the structure; you provide the soul.
- "I'm Not Seeing Ranking Improvements." SEO takes time. It can take 3-6 months to see significant traction from a new content strategy, even with AI. Check your Google Search Console for impressions. Often, impressions will rise before clicks and rankings do, which is an early sign that you're on the right track. Also, ensure your technical SEO is solid. The fastest content engine in the world won't work on a site Google can't crawl efficiently.
- "I'm Worried About Google Penalties." Google's stance is clear: they reward helpful content, regardless of how it's made. If you use AI to create thin, spammy, unoriginal content, you risk a penalty. If you use AI as part of a system to create well-researched, comprehensive, and genuinely helpful content that serves searcher intent, you are aligning with Google's goals.
